“Like a musician understands the importance of silence, a dancer must understand the importance of stillness, and yoga can open us up to that aspect of dance.” In this episode we speak with Tai Jimenez. We discuss the benefits of yoga for dancers, beginning a meditation practice, reaching a flow state of movement, and finding happiness within limitations. Tai also shares challenges that she has faced during her professional career and the creation of a movement meditation called soft pop. About Tai: Tai is a Professor of Dance at the Boston Conservatory teaching ballet technique. Tai has been a principal dancer with both Dance Theater of Harlem and Boston Ballet. She is also a certified yoga instructor teaching at both JP Yoga and Raquel Mara Movement Collective. She has created a movement meditation called Soft Pop. In an episode first broadcast August 26, 2013, host Andrew Sandoval plays twenty 1960's 45's collected from his recent travels through the United States working with The Monkees. These include singles by: The Berkeley Kites, The Lime, The Impact Express, The In-Keepers, The Scene, The Lovin', Crowd +1, Bazooka, The Long Brothers, Disciples of Shaftesbury, Bobby Lile, The Chips, Johnny Draper, The Fireballs, dRAKE, The Higher Elevation, The Hamilton Face Band, The Back Seat, The Downtown Collection and Crib & Ben. Hour two features 20 slices of the Five Americans in MONO! Many of these sides have never appeared on CD, let alone in mono, and if you are not familiar with the songwriting of Mike Rabon, Norman Ezell & John Durrill, you are in for both an education and a treat. From Garage to Pop to Baroque to Psych to Bubblegum to Soft Pop to total Heavyocity, these five Americans pretty much did it all.

So the theme for this is 60s music, but avoiding the collectors scenes of garage and northern soul. What I ended up with was this great set of soft pop, haunted by the spirit of the Pye and Immediate labels. I was going to make it like an ordinary radio show at first, with spoken links, cause I felt I had a lot to say about the songs at the time. That was a couple of months ago though, so now I just mixed them together as they are. I hope you will appreciate the blending of some proper hits with more obscure would-be hits. Like the British group Thursday's Children who only released one single in 1965. And "Among the First to Know" which is one of my all-time faves, and has been covered by The Happy Balloon. The Mascots was a Swedish Hollies-styled group, here showing off their freakbeat side with a track from their great and only lp *EELPEE*. The American Breed had a couple of hits, but this string-laden ballad can't keep me from thinking of Belle & Sebastian. The Chants are notable for being a black vocal group from Liverpool, whose live debut took place in 1962 with The Beatles backing them. Read their story here: http://www.triumphpc.com/mersey-beat/a-z/chants.shtml! The group The Missing Links here is not the Australian one, but an American with one single to their name. Harmony Grass was a late 60s mutation of the Beach Boys-influenced Tony Rivers & the Castaways.
